When they ask, ‘Why did she quit?’

Q: We had a superstar here who quit because she couldn’t take the C-suite’s bad decision-making anymore. Now since I’m fairly high up the ladder, several people are asking me what happened. How much honesty can I afford here?

A: Well, you’ve got to give a little, because if it’s one thing I’ve learned, it’s that employees make up their own stories when they’re denied information, and that’s never good. Tell them that she had philosophical differences with the company, and that building a career is all about finding the place where what you want aligns with what those above you want. Remind them that we all face a conflict like that at some point in our careers, and rarely is it a case of someone being right and another person being wrong. Make it a parable about their own lives and they’ll walk away feeling they got a good answer.
